3 hurt in bomb attack
Source: Hueiyen News Service
Imphal, November 17 2012:
At least three persons including two salesmen and the owner of an iron store sustained injuries when unidentified miscreants hurled a hand grenade inside a shop at New Checkon under Porompat police station today.
The bomb attack took place at around 1:30 pm at Sudhir Iron Store.
The three persons who sustained injuring in the bomb attack have been identified as Shikander Shah (37), s/o Chaodhuri Shah of Bihar but presently staying in a rented house at Majorkhul; Lakshmi Shah (37), s/o Barti Shah of Bihar, who also is presently staying at Majorkhul and Athokpam Babudhon (58), s/o late Tonjonbi of Keishamthong Thangjam Leirak.
Shikandar Shah is said to be the owner of the iron store and the other two are salesmen.
Shikandar and Laxmi suffered injuries in the bellies while Babudhon sustained injuries on both his legs.
The injured trio was first rushed to Public Hospital for treatment.
From there, they were later shifted to Shija Hospital.
Soon after the report of the bomb attack reached, a team of Imphal East District Police arrived at the spot and carried out extensive search operation.
According to police report, two unidentified persons coming on a Honda Activa stopped in front of Sudhir Iron Store and hurled the hand grenade inside the shop.
The assailants fled the area soon after the attack.
Meanwhile, another bomb exploded at Nongpok Keithelmanbi Sambrei Lamkhai area in Yairipok at around at around 5:30 am today.
The bomb was believed to have been planted to target security personnel.
According to police report, the bomb went off soon after a security convoy passed the area.
No one was hurt in the blast.
